English Literature for Young People Format:DigitalIntroduction to the history of English literature. Best for ages 10 14. English Literature for Young People is a 624 page guide to the great works of English literature. H. E. Marshall's story of Englands literary heritage is rich and compelling a masterly account of 1500 years of the literary arts in Great Britain, extending from early Irish legends through the Golden Age of English letters to the modern age.
